Samsung has finally introduced a new one Galaxy S23 Ultra camera. This is the 200MPx ISOCELL HP2 photo sensor that has been speculated for so long. It is already the fourth 200MPx sensor of the Korean giant and, according to him, it offers significantly better image and video quality.

The ISOCELL HP2 is a 1/1.3-inch sensor with a pixel size of 0,6 microns. It is thus smaller than the sensor ISOCELL HP1 (1/1.22-inch size with 0,64-micron pixels), which was introduced the year before. Samsung however he claims, that the ISOCELL HP2 is its most advanced sensor to date, as it features D-VTG (Dual Vertical Transfer Gate) technology that increases the full capacity of each pixel by more than 33%, resulting in better color reproduction and reduced overexposure.

The new sensor also features Tetra2Pixel binning technology, which, depending on the ambient light, can take 50MPx images with 1,2 micron pixel size (4in1 binning) or 12,5MPx photos with 2,4 micron pixels (16in1 binning). It also supports up to 8K video recording at 30 fps with a wider field of view in 50MPx mode, which means it uses larger pixels at this resolution than previous generations of models in the range Galaxy S.

According to Samsung, the ISOCELL HP2 offers faster and more reliable autofocus in low-light conditions thanks to Super QPD (Quad Phase Detection) technology. It can also take 200 photos in one second at full 15 MPx resolution, making it the Korean giant's fastest 200 MPx sensor to date.

For improved HDR, the new sensor in 50MPx mode uses DSG (Dual Signal Gain) technology, which captures short and long exposures simultaneously, meaning it can capture pixel-level HDR images and videos. The sensor also features Smart ISO Pro, which allows the phone to simultaneously capture 12,5MP photos and 4K HDR video at 60 fps.

The ISOCELL HP2 has already gone into mass production, which almost certainly means it will be fitted to Samsung's next top-of-the-line flagship Galaxy S23 Ultra. Advice Galaxy S23 will be presented in about two weeks.
